Table 4 Multivariable Cox proportional hazard regression on the dependent variables of CVD event and all-cause mortality

From: Statin use reduces cardiovascular events and all-cause mortality amongst Chinese patients with type 2 diabetes mellitus: a 5-year cohort study

 

Statin Group Comparing with Comparison Group

HRa

95%CI

P-value

Main Analysis (N = 20,208)

 CVD

0.458

(0.415,0.504)

<0.001*

  CHD

0.436

(0.380,0.502)

<0.001*

  Heart Failure

0.488

(0.402,0.593)

<0.001*

  Stroke

0.429

(0.368,0.499)

<0.001*

 All-cause Mortality

0.378

(0.331,0.431)

<0.001*

Sensitivity Analysis (N = 15,776)

 CVD

0.522

(0.462,0.589)

<0.001*

  CHD

0.467

(0.390,0.559)

<0.001*

  Heart Failure

0.581

(0.454,0.742)

<0.001*

  Stroke

0.516

(0.428,0.622)

<0.001*

 All-cause Mortality

0.382

(0.325,0.450)

<0.001*

  1. Sensitivity analysis: exclude subjects with follow-up period less than 2 years
  2. CVD Cardiovascular Disease, CHD Coronary Heart Disease, HR Hazard Ratio, CI Confidence Interval
  3. *p-value <0.05
  4. aHazard ratios were adjusted by age, gender, smoking status, haemoglobin A1c, systolic blood pressure, diastolic blood pressure, triglyceride, low density liporotein-cholesterol, body mass index, total cholesterol-to-high density lipoprotein-cholesterol ratio, presence of chronic kidney disease, duration of diabetes mellitus, Charlson Index, diagnosed hypertension, family history of diabetes mellitus and usages of insulin, oral and anti-hypertensive drugs index at baseline
